“Tharaud's range of touch and colour, and his sheer enthusiasm, shine through every jewel-like piece.”  These are the words of critic Andrew Clements of The Guardian, London on Alexandre Tharaud’s latest CD featuring a selection of Scarlatti Sonatas.

Already established as one of today’s most individual and thoughtful pianists, Alexandre Tharaud has appeared at the Köln Philharmonie, the South Bank piano series in London, the Rudolfinum in Prague, the Théâtre des Champs-Elysées, the Concertgebouw in Amsterdam, the Teatro Colón in Buenos Aires and the Kennedy Centre in Washington. His festival credits include La Roque d'Anthéron, the BBC PROMS, and the Rimini festival.

Alexandre Tharaud made a series of successful recordings with Harmonia Mundi including Jean-Philippe Rameau's Nouvelles Pièces de Clavecin and Ravel's complete works for solo piano, which received many awards including Diapason d'Or de l'Année, Stern des Monats from Fono Forum and Best CD of the year from de Standaard. His recording of a selection of Couperin's pieces reached the Top 20 in the German classical charts and was CHOC de l'année 2007 by Monde de la Musique. More recently he has recorded albums of Chopin and Scarlatti for Virgin, which have garnered similar praise.

Alexandre Tharaud 's adventurous approach to programming has resulted in a number of commissions and premières; he has toured extensively in Europe with his ‘Hommages à Rameau' and ‘Hommage à Couperin' programmes which feature works by the old masters interwoven with tributes by contemporary composers.
